The Trouble in China.
London, August 27. The Times’ Shanghai correspondent understands that the French are de l mending concessions in the island of Ngaohvrei, in Southern China. Hong Kong, August 23. The Grand Council of tha Ohineld Empire has decided that tha Court shall go permanently to the new capital In tbft Province of Honan. It is reported at Singanfu that Rdssift has consolidated her position in ootef Mongolia.
